Who Made Early Christianity?

Discover the intricate dynamics between Judaism and Christianity in "Who Made Early Christianity?" by John G. Gager. Published by Columbia University Press in 2015, this thought-provoking hardback explores the historical and social factors that contributed to the division between these two influential religions. With a keen eye for detail, Gager examines the role of Paul in shaping early Christian identity and the resulting tensions that emerged. Spanning 208 pages, this revisionist history invites readers to reconsider long-held beliefs and engages with the complex relations that have defined Christianity's origins. Perfect for scholars, students, or anyone interested in religious history, Gager's work provides valuable insights into how these faiths evolved and interacted with one another.
